Handover: Bramwell Freight SFTP drop. Their nightly manifests land in the inbound partner share; parser runs at 02:15. If the drop is empty, retry job manually — don't wait for Bramwell to call. Key rotation happened last week, so the old host key warnings are expected through Friday. Ownership moves from Dev (me, Torsten) to support as of Monday. Vault access for the drop account is restored with the phrase below. Use the recovery passphrase that follows this line.

strongbox words: zoreth-fraox-oliius-aldeth-jorax-praeth-holmir-drumir-prawyn

**Vendor note: Inkmill markdown pipeline**

Rendering for Parchway docs is outsourced to Inkmill under an annual contract, renewing each March. They handle sanitization and PDF export; we own the upload queue. SLA: 4-hour response on rendering failures. Escalate only after two failed retries. Their support desk is reachable at the address below.

billing contact of hahaf-baguf = zorael.tammir.jorius@sivrelhq.internal

## Deployment

Brindlecote uses a shared connection pool fronting the primary Postgres cluster. Each replica of the API opens at most one pool; never raise the per-pod limit without checking the database's max connections in the Hallowmere environment. Pool exhaustion shows up as 503s, not timeouts. The pool is configured with the following values.

deployment values, kajep-kageg:
[praix]
host = praix.paliqcorp.corp
user = praix_svc
database = praix_prod

## Graphlet for Plugin Authors

Graphlet renders your plugin's dependency tree from the manifest at build time. Cycles are flagged red; optional deps render dashed. Your plugin must emit a valid `deps.lock` or the visualizer shows an empty canvas. Layout is deterministic per manifest hash, so diffs are stable across builds. Sandbox access is granted within two business days of registration. To request sandbox credentials, write to the tooling desk.

escalation mailbox, yajef-hawef: druix@qirvancorp.internal

# Canary Gating: Who to Contact

Canary deploys on the Pellwood platform are gated by the Sentry-Gate ruleset: error-rate delta under 0.5% and p99 latency within 10% of baseline for 30 minutes. On-call engineers may not override gates without approval from the release stewards. If a gate appears stuck or is blocking a critical hotfix, contact the gating rotation immediately.

escalation mailbox, badug-tawip: ulaath@nelvroforge.example